2 clownfish is ok for a 20 gallon although 30 gallon is preferable. Those anthias do not belong in there imo. I would try to get most of those fish a good home, the crowding cannot possibly be good for them.

I say this because you asked. Personally I would have brought them to my LFS before putting them all into a 20g no matter how temporary I felt the situation to be. In the end, all that matters is the animals well being. I know you mean well and have only the best intentions but it is best to get it down to just a few, the rest should go.

This way you can focus your energy and money on solving the bigger tank issue.
